➢ 熟练使用FrameWork 或者私有 pod 实现组件化开发。
➢ 深入理解OC的RunTime动态运行、RunLoop的循环机制和OC内存管理
➢ 熟悉Runtime 等系统底层实现并能运用其实现特定需求。
➢ 熟练使用git、SVN 进行项目管理。
➢ 熟练使用QuartzCore 框架进行各种绘图和动画效果。
➢ 熟练运用Instrument 进行 App 性能优化。
➢ 熟练使用charles 进行网络抓包。
➢ 熟练使用fastlane+jenkins搭建CI/CD架构,能独立完成项目的架构搭建。
➢ 熟悉GCD多线程开发,熟悉线程同步、异步、串行、并发及线程锁的相关操作
➢ codereview。
➢ 使用Cocoapod 实现第三方库的统一管理以及私有库的制作。
➢ 熟练使用appledoc、jazzy 生成项目文档。
➢ 具有安卓,iOS,OpenGL ES,Metal开发经验
➢ 熟练掌握SDK静态库Library和Framework开发
1、 负责公司 iOS 应用的开发(APP从0到1)、技术调研并给予技术指导(iOS团队8人) 2、负责 iOS 的项目管理,CodeReview。
3、 作为主程参与项目开发,攻克技术难点。 4、对项目的开发进行评估,并把握项目进度。 5、引领技术方向,在项目空闲期组织团队学习,并分享各自成果。
1.带领开发和测试人员开发APP安卓和iOS端并发布到应用市场 2.根据产品经理的需求开发相应新功能和版本迭代 3. 帮助同事解决了App中非常严重蓝牙BLE问题和其它问题 4. 带领团队进行技术分享,codereview 5. 用git和SVN进行项目管理 6.生成
1、 负责公司 iOS 应用的开发(APP从0到1)、技术调研并给予技术指导(iOS团队8人) 2、负责 iOS 的项目管理,CodeReview。 3、 作为主程参与项目开发,攻克技术难点。 4、对项目的开发进行评估,并把握项目进度。 5、引领技术方向,在项目空闲